The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Cape Girardeau County or the community of Egypt Mills: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Egypt Mills:
    • GNIS ID for Egypt Mills: 717419
    • GNIS ID for Cape Girardeau County: 758470
    • GNIS ID for State of Missouri: 1779791
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Egypt Mills is located in Census Region #2 (the Midwest Region) and Division #4 (the West North-Central Division).
